Finding the Perfect Rental for Your Needs

Securing the ideal rental can be a daunting task. With so many alternatives available, it's simple to become overwhelmed. However, by following some key steps and considering your individual requirements, you can focus to the perfect rental apartment.
First, figure out your spending plan. This will help screen any rentals that are above your price range. Next, make a list of your critical requirements, such as the number of bedrooms and bathrooms, washing machine, and garage.
When you have a clear understanding of your needs and budget, commence your search. There are numerous online resources available to help you find rentals in your area. Don't hesitate to contact landlords or property managers personally to schedule viewings.
When viewing a potential rental, give close attention to the condition of the property, as well as the neighborhood. Ask questions about amenities and lease terms. By taking your time and doing your due diligence, you can maximize your chances of finding the perfect rental for your needs.

Understanding Tenant Rights and Responsibilities
As a tenant, being aware of your rights and responsibilities is essential for a positive renting situation.
Initially, familiarize yourself with the legal structure governing tenant-landlord relations in your area. This often includes state laws and ordinances that outline expectations for both parties.
Additionally, review your lease agreement meticulously. It serves as a binding contract that details the terms of your tenancy, including rent schedule, maintenance obligations, and allowable applications for the property.
Comprehend that tenants have certain rights, such as the right to a livable dwelling free from dangerous conditions, the right to privacy within their unit, and the right to reasonable treatment by landlords. Conversely, tenants also have responsibilities, including paying rent on time, maintaining the property in good condition, and adhering the terms of the lease agreement.
Open conversation between tenants and landlords is crucial for resolving any potential concerns that may arise.
